Worldwide Operations organization
The Worldwide Operations organization is looking for an Executive Assistant who wants to work in a fast-paced, exciting, and growing organization. We need someone who is bright and motivated, with a proven history of high performance and a proactive EA leader to support the Vice President of Delivery Experience in Seattle, Washington. This role requires outstanding planning, time management, and organizational skills. Superior attention to detail and the ability to meet tight deadlines and juggle multiple requests is critical. A high level of integrity and discretion in handling confidential information, and professionalism in dealing with senior executives is imperative. A good sense of humor is a must, as is the ability to be flexible and change direction at a moment’s notice.
